Product Overview

Category: Integrated Circuit (IC)

Use: Power Management IC

Characteristics: - High efficiency - Low power consumption - Compact size - Wide input voltage range - Multiple protection features

Package: QFN (Quad Flat No-leads)

Essence: MP38894DN-LF-Z is a power management IC designed for efficient power conversion and management in various electronic devices.

Packaging/Quantity: The MP38894DN-LF-Z is available in a QFN package. The quantity per package may vary depending on the supplier.

Specifications

The MP38894DN-LF-Z has the following specifications:

  • Input Voltage Range: 4.5V to 28V
  • Output Voltage Range: 0.8V to 5.5V
  • Maximum Output Current: 3A
  • Switching Frequency: 1.2MHz
  • Operating Temperature Range: -40°C to +85°C

Working Principles

The MP38894DN-LF-Z operates on the principle of pulse width modulation (PWM) to regulate the output voltage. It uses a high-frequency switching transistor to control the energy flow from the input to the output, achieving efficient power conversion.
